Welcome to Hanoi! Start your city experience by immersing yourself in the bustling atmosphere of the Old Quarter. In the morning, take a stroll through the narrow streets lined with traditional shophouses and enjoy the scent of street food. In the afternoon, visit Hoan Kiem Lake and Ngoc Son Temple, located in the heart of the city. As the evening sets in, explore the vibrant night market in the Old Quarter, where you can bargain for souvenirs and taste delicious street food.
Start your day by visiting the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um Complex, where you can pay respects to the country's beloved leader. In the afternoon, explore the Temple of Literature, Vietnam's first national university. As the evening approaches, take a walk around the French Quarter, known for its colonial architecture and charming cafes.
Spend your morning exploring the Vietnam Museum of Ethnology, where you can learn about the country's diverse ethnic groups. In the afternoon, visit the Vietnam Fine Arts Museum and admire its impressive collection of Vietnamese art. As the evening sets in, take a cyclo ride around the famous Hoan Kiem Lake and enjoy the city's vibrant nightlife.
Start your day with a food tour in Hanoi's Old Quarter, where you can sample various local dishes such as pho, banh mi, and egg coffee. In the afternoon, visit the Museum of Ethnology to deepen your understanding of Vietnam's rich cultural traditions. As the evening approaches, watch a traditional water puppet show, a unique Vietnamese art form.
Embark on a full-day excursion to the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Halong Bay. Explore the stunning limestone islands and caves aboard a traditional junk boat, and enjoy a seafood lunch on board. Take in the breathtaking scenery and dip your toes in the crystal-clear waters before returning to Hanoi in the evening.
Visit the beautiful Tran Quoc Pagoda, the oldest Buddhist temple in Hanoi, located on the shores of West Lake. In the afternoon, explore the peaceful surroundings of the Perfume Pagoda, a complex of Buddhist temples nestled in a scenic landscape. As the evening sets in, enjoy a leisurely walk around West Lake and savor the tranquility.
Discover the modern side of Hanoi by visiting the Lotte Center and taking an elevator ride to the observation deck for panoramic views of the city. In the afternoon, explore the Vietnamese Women's Museum, which showcases the contributions and achievements of Vietnamese women throughout history. As the evening approaches, indulge in a delicious Vietnamese dinner at a rooftop restaurant overlooking the city.
For an off-the-beaten-path experience, head to the Train Street in the Old Quarter, where you can witness the unique sight of trains passing through a narrow residential street. Don't forget to try "Bun Cha" at a local eatery, a traditional Hanoi dish consisting of grilled pork and noodles. To relax like a local, visit West Lake and rent a bicycle to explore the peaceful lakeside path.
